A particle of spin 1/2 has three basic properties:

  1. 1.

    It bears an intrinsic vector property that does not depend upon space coordinates.

  2. 2.

    This vector is an angular momentum (= spin) to be added to the orbital momentum of the particle.

  3. 3.

    If one of the components of the spin is measured, the result can be only one of its two eigenvalues, +1/2h or -1/2h.
